April is National Volunteer Month, and we celebrate our ATPE members who go above and beyond—today and every day—to uplift their schools and communities.

ATPE’s volunteer network includes thousands of members statewide who are dedicated to recruiting new members, providing a support network for current members, influencing legislation, and representing our organization at the local and state level.
